§ 18A:20-9.1 — Conveyance of certain sewer lines to a municipality

Text

Upon the request or with the concurrence of the governing body of a municipality the board of education of any district is authorized to convey and transfer, without consideration, its right, title and interest in and to any trunk or other sewer line to the municipality in which it is situated subject to the continued right of the district to use the same together with such other use as may be authorized by the governing body of the municipality. L.1967, c.271.
